The Errored Frame Event counts the number of errored frames detected during
the specified period. The period is specified by a time interval ( Window in order
of 1 sec). This event is generated if the errored frame count is equal to or
greater than the specified threshold for that period (Period Threshold). Errored
frames are frames that had transmission errors as detected at the Media Access
Control sublayer. Error Window for 'Error Frame Event' must be an integer value
between 1-60 and its default value is '1'. Whereas Error Threshold must be
between 0-4294967295 and its default value is '1'.
